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Farningham Road to Knaresborough start from as little as £46.30

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Farningham Road to Knaresborough start from £79.30 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Farningham Road to Knaresborough are available for £183.70 one way

Facilities and Amenities

Farningham Road train station, though compact, is equipped with the essentials for a comfortable journey. The ticket office operates weekdays from 6:10 AM to 10:30 AM, with ticket machines available for those needing to purchase or collect tickets outside these hours. Conveniently, the station provides accessible ticket machines by the entrance to platform 1.

While there are no step-free interchanges between platforms, accessibility remains a priority. Step-free access is available for services towards London from platform 1 and away from London via an unmade footpath to platform 2. Assistance for those with reduced mobility is actively provided, with staffed help points present to make your journey as effortless as possible during specific hours.

Additional Amenities

Travelers will find a delightful coffee kiosk to grab a refreshing drink before their journey. Unfortunately, the station lacks several amenities such as Wi-Fi, public toilets, and a waiting room. Car parking is managed by APCOA, with 36 spaces and a reasonable daily rate, ensuring your vehicle is safely stationed while you travel. For those on two wheels, cycle stands are available for bicycle storage.

Facilities and Amenities at Knaresborough Station

As you step into Knaresborough Station, be ready to experience convenient access to essential facilities ensuring a comfortable journey. Although the station lacks a ticket office, worry not—the ticket machines are available and accessible for collecting pre-booked online tickets. The station is equipped with smartcard validators and accessible ticket machines too, ensuring a user-friendly experience for all passengers. Always eco-conscious, the station invites you to enjoy its biking facilities, offering 16 spaces for bicycle storage by the subway access. For quick refreshments, ‘The Old Ticket Office’ café is situated right on the platform, perfect for grabbing a coffee while you wait for your train.

If you need assistance or travel information, while there is no staff available on-site, the station is equipped with Help Points. Assistance is provided by conductors on request, ensuring ease of travel for everyone. CCTV systems ensure a secure environment while you're at the station. However, travellers should note the absence of public restrooms, waiting rooms, and other amenities like ATMs or free Wi-Fi.
